Transaction 7486e697c34e3eb1d5a6e722427c6925366b5992b11bb7aba83d1d6f50cf38d6

1 Input
2 Outputs
  • 7486e697c34e3eb1d5a6e722427c6925366b5992b11bb7aba83d1d6f50cf38d6:0
  • value  2511822
    address  1PJRnfrr3hd74aL1sjEAR8qwWjURXZNw3h
  • 7486e697c34e3eb1d5a6e722427c6925366b5992b11bb7aba83d1d6f50cf38d6:1
  • value  3761100
    address  34PSH3oQbTGW6Gmh2HdgmhDcidrahYDTha